  • by eldavojohn (898314) * <my/.username@@@gmail.com> on Tuesday May 05 2009, @10:18AM (#27831291) Homepage Journal
    On the Shoulders of Giants [amazon.com] was a book I picked up on the cheap ... a weighty tome assembled by Stephen Hawking of classic books of science (some of which you listed).

    I think I got the hardcover for ~$8 at a used bookstore. Amazon seems to indicate it's not available on the kindle but here's what's in it:

    1. Nicolaus Copernicus "On the Revolutions of [the] Heavenly Spheres" (1543)

    2. Galileo Galilei "Dialogues [or Discourses and Mathematical Demonstrations] Concerning Two [New] Sciences" (1638)

    3. Johannes Kepler Book Five of "Harmonies of the World" (1618)

    4. Sir Isaac Newton "The Mathematical Principles of Natural Philosophy" (1687)

    5. Albert Einstein "The Principles of Relativity: A Collection of Original Papers on the Special Theory of Relativity" (1922)

    • by CraftyJack (1031736) on Tuesday May 05 2009, @11:04AM (#27832113)

      If your goal is to learn the subject material, I wouldn't bother with most - equivalents from the 20th century may likely be better.

      Important question there. Keep in mind that notation and scientific writing style have changed significantly over the years.

      • That and seminal works are often overhyped. Don't get me wrong - they may have made a great impact, but they're usually indicative of the beginning of a new field, and it may have taken decades/centuries for the field to figure itself out. Only then is it presented in a better manner for learning.

        Take calculus. Limits weren't put on a firm rigorous basis till people like Bolzano, Weierstrauss and Cauchy over a hundred years after Newton. And general integration theory didn't come around until the late 19th century and early 20th.

        Of course, there are always exceptions...

  • by Ecuador (740021) on Tuesday May 05 2009, @10:54AM (#27831963) Homepage

    Well, how about going further back. Copernicus is quite "modern" I would say. He himself had read the work of Aristarchus from the 3rd century BC entitled "On sizes and distances", which not only proposes the heliocentric theory, but even does calculations on the sizes and distances (didn't expect that?) of the Sun and the Moon.
    Allow me to note here that although the heliocentric theory was not accepted by many in ancient Greece, the fact that the earth and the heavenly bodies were spheres was common knowledge from the 5th/4th century BC. In fact by the 3rd century BC they knew the radius within 10%. So sad that all this knowledge was lost for centuries...
    Anyway, another classic book that is almost a century older than Aristarchus' book is Aristotle's "Physica" (or "Physics"). Aristotle wrote on many subjects (e.g. politics, ethics, physics etc) and his works an all fields were considered the definitive works of the era.
    I know you said science, but I thought I should also mention the oldest Science-Fiction book I have read, which is Lucian's "True Story" or "True History" (the Greek word is the same for both, in any case the title has the same effect). The two science books I mentioned are not that easy reads, however this one is a very amusing book from the 2nd century AD. I mean it has battles on the Moon, what else do you want!

  • affectation (Score:3, Insightful)

    by bcrowell (177657) on Tuesday May 05 2009, @11:26AM (#27832539) Homepage

    My advice would be not to make an affectation of reading original works. Here [nytimes.com] is a good article that discusses this "Great Books" paradigm, and points out how poorly it fits in the sciences especially.

    One example you gave was Newton's Principia. Well, I'm a physicist, and I've read most of the Principia. I would not recommend it to anyone. First off, it's all written in the language of Euclidean geometry, merely because most of Newton's audience wasn't familiar with algebra, and certainly not with calculus, which had only been published a few years before the Principia came out. Today, the way to approach the subject is to read a treatment that uses modern math that you're familiar with. If you know calculus and analytic geometry, you can read a two-page proof [lightandmatter.com] of the elliptical orbit law, a result that took Newton the bulk of his entire book to prove because of the mathematical tools to which he limited himself.

    Of course there are exceptions to every rule. I think the first 1/3 of Euclid's Elements is still something that everyone interested in mathematics should read.
